Journal ArticleDOI

Biocompatibility of Graphene Oxide

TL;DR: Graphene oxides exhibit dose-dependent toxicity to cells and animals, such as inducing cell apoptosis and lung granuloma formation, and cannot be cleaned by kidney.

Journal ArticleDOI

Effects of miR-146a on the osteogenesis of adipose-derived mesenchymal stem cells and bone regeneration

TL;DR: It is shown that miR-146a negatively regulates the osteogenesis and bone regeneration from ADSCs both in vitro and in vivo.
Journal ArticleDOI

HER2 monoclonal antibody conjugated RNase-A-associated CdTe quantum dots for targeted imaging and therapy of gastric cancer.

TL;DR: High-performance HER2-RQDs nanoprobes exhibit great potential in applications such as in-situ gastric cancer targeted imaging, and selective therapy in the near future.
